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"obtaining validation from"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when discussing the process of seeking approval, confirmation, or verification from a source or authority. Example: "The team is focused on obtaining validation from the stakeholders before proceeding with the project."

Ludwig's WRAP-UP
The phrase "obtaining validation from" is a grammatically correct and usable phrase, though relatively rare in general usage. As Ludwig AI suggests, it is predominantly used in scientific and academic contexts to describe the process of seeking confirmation or approval, thus indicating a formal register. The phrase's function is to emphasize the importance of external verification, and alternatives such as "securing validation from" or "getting confirmation from" can be used depending on the specific nuance you wish to convey. When using this phrase, ensure you clearly identify the source of validation to enhance clarity and credibility.

FAQs
How can I use "obtaining validation from" in a sentence?
You can use "obtaining validation from" to describe the process of seeking confirmation or approval from a specific source. For example, "The researcher is focused on obtaining validation from experts in the field".
What are some alternatives to "obtaining validation from"?
Some alternatives include "securing validation from", "getting confirmation from", or "acquiring approval from", depending on the context.
Is "obtaining validation from" formal or informal?
The phrase "obtaining validation from" is generally considered formal and is appropriate for academic, scientific, or professional contexts.
What does it mean to "obtain validation from" someone?
To "obtain validation from" someone means to receive confirmation, approval, or verification from that person or entity, typically indicating that something meets a certain standard or is considered correct.
